Authorization Bypass Through User-Controlled Key vulnerability in Turpak Automatic Station Monitoring System allows Privilege Escalation. This issue affects Automatic Station Monitoring System: before 5.0.6.51.

This is an IDOR (Insecure Direct Object Reference) style authorization bypass where the application uses user-controlled parameters (keys) to determine access rights without proper validation. An attacker can manipulate these keys to bypass authorization checks and escalate privileges from a lower-privileged account to administrative or higher-level access.

MitigationUpgrade Turpak Automatic Station Monitoring System to version 5.0.6.51 or later. As an interim measure, implement strict server-side authorization validation on all user-supplied parameters before granting access to resources or privileged operations.

Work through these to decide whether this CVE applies to you.

  1. Identify if Turpak Automatic Station Monitoring System is installed
    Check the installed software inventory or list of running services for 'Turbopak' or 'Automatic Station Monitoring System'
    Affected if The system is present in the environment
  2. Determine the installed version
    Use the system's built-in version check command, check the About dialog, or examine the application metadata files if accessible
    Affected if The version is lower than 5.0.6.51 or cannot be determined (treat unknown versions as potentially affected)
  3. Review application logs for authorization anomalies
    Examine application and audit logs for unusual access patterns, privilege escalation attempts, or failed authorization checks involving parameter manipulation
    Affected if Logs show access patterns where user-supplied parameters (keys) were used to access resources outside the user's intended permission scope
  4. Check for user-controlled parameter usage in access control logic
    Inspect application configuration or code if accessible to identify if access control decisions rely on user-supplied parameters (keys) without server-side validation
    Affected if The application uses user-controlled keys/parameters for authorization decisions without proper validation

A user is affected if Turpak Automatic Station Monitoring System is installed with a version before 5.0.6.51 and the application uses user-supplied parameters for access control decisions.
